PATA? parallel ata?
hi i hav an old dell id like to supe up with a new 250gb 16mb maxtor harddrive. The problem is my ide interface supports ata-133 and scsi will it support parallel ata?

ata-133 is pata. pata is the typical connection that every motherboard has on it

It's just another one of those things just to confuse you, cause standard IDE interface for drives have been PATA all along but you just never heard it called that, but now that there is SATA, they are using the term PATA to differentiate between the new and the old.
